bibliothek.gui.dock.common.action.predefined
Class CNormalizeAction

java.lang.Object
  extended by bibliothek.gui.dock.common.action.CAction
      extended by bibliothek.gui.dock.common.intern.action.CDecorateableAction<A>
          extended by bibliothek.gui.dock.common.intern.action.CDropDownItem<CExtendedModeAction.Action>
              extended by bibliothek.gui.dock.common.intern.action.CExtendedModeAction
                  extended by bibliothek.gui.dock.common.action.predefined.CNormalizeAction

public class CNormalizeAction
extends CExtendedModeAction

An action that normalizes each CDockable to which it is added.

Author:
Benjamin Sigg

Nested Class Summary
 
Nested classes/interfaces inherited from class bibliothek.gui.dock.common.intern.action.CExtendedModeAction
CExtendedModeAction.Action
 
Constructor Summary
CNormalizeAction(CControl control)
          Creates a new action
 
Method Summary
protected  CExtendedModeAction.Action createAction()
          Creates an instance of the action representing this CExtendedModeAction.
 
Methods inherited from class bibliothek.gui.dock.common.intern.action.CExtendedModeAction
action, checkTrigger, getController, init, setController
 
Methods inherited from class bibliothek.gui.dock.common.intern.action.CDropDownItem
isDropDownSelectable, isDropDownTriggerableNotSelected, isDropDownTriggerableSelected, setDropDownSelectable, setDropDownTriggerableNotSelected, setDropDownTriggerableSelected
 
Methods inherited from class bibliothek.gui.dock.common.intern.action.CDecorateableAction
addDecorateableActionListener, getAccelerator, getDisabledHoverIcon, getDisabledIcon, getDisabledPressedIcon, getHoverIcon, getIcon, getPressedIcon, getText, getTooltip, init, intern, isEnabled, isShowTextOnButtons, removeDecorateableActionListener, setAccelerator, setDisabledHoverIcon, setDisabledIcon, setDisabledPressedIcon, setEnabled, setHoverIcon, setIcon, setPressedIcon, setShowTextOnButtons, setText, setTooltip
 
Methods inherited from class bibliothek.gui.dock.common.action.CAction
init
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

CNormalizeAction

public CNormalizeAction(CControl control)
Creates a new action

Parameters:
control - the control for which this action will be used
Method Detail

createAction

protected CExtendedModeAction.Action createAction()
Description copied from class: CExtendedModeAction
Creates an instance of the action representing this CExtendedModeAction.

Overrides:
createAction in class CExtendedModeAction
Returns:
the action